Testosterone Treatments
Testosterone treatments have emerged as a significant area of interest in the realm of men’s health. Addressing low testosterone levels can have profound effects on an individual’s physical and mental well-being. Symptoms of low testosterone, such as fatigue, decreased libido, and mood swings, can significantly impact one’s quality of life, making timely intervention crucial.
There are various approaches to managing low testosterone levels. Treatment options range from hormone replacement therapy to lifestyle modifications, such as improved diet and exercise routines. Healthcare providers often emphasize a balanced approach, considering each patient’s specific needs and goals to determine the most appropriate treatment plan.
The importance of monitoring and managing testosterone levels cannot be overstated. Regular check-ups with a healthcare provider can help identify any underlying hormonal imbalances and ensure that the chosen treatment regime effectively addresses the condition. As awareness around men’s health continues to grow, testosterone treatments remain a vital aspect of promoting overall well-being and vitality.

Urgent Health Care
Immediate health care services are vital for addressing acute medical issues that require swift intervention. Urgent health care clinics provide a convenient alternative to hospital emergency rooms, offering timely and efficient care for non-life-threatening injuries and illnesses. These facilities are often equipped to handle a broad spectrum of conditions, from minor fractures and cuts to severe flu symptoms.
The accessibility and effectiveness of immediate health care services minimize the strain on hospital emergency departments, reducing wait times and ensuring attention for critical cases. Dedicated healthcare practitioners and modern diagnostic equipment in urgent care settings streamline the process of receiving appropriate treatment without the need for prior appointments. Patients benefit from access to quality care in a timely manner, safeguarding health and avoiding complications.
Moreover, urgent care facilities often provide extended hours and are located conveniently in many communities, making them an excellent resource for busy individuals. They also offer a range of services, including immunizations, physical exams, and laboratory tests, thus contributing to comprehensive healthcare management. Through the provision of immediate health care, these clinics remain a cornerstone of efficient and effective health service delivery in contemporary society.

Eye Health Services
Regular eye check-ups play a significant role in maintaining vision and preventing eye disease. Local eye exams conducted by optometrists allow for comprehensive evaluations that assess visual acuity and diagnose potential issues that may affect sight. Eye health services remain a crucial element in the broader health care framework, promoting long-term eye and overall health.
Routine eye exams are essential for preventive care, detecting conditions like glaucoma, cataracts, and macular degeneration in their early stages. These examinations can also identify systemic health issues that manifest symptoms through the eyes, such as diabetes and hypertension. By detecting such issues promptly, eye health services facilitate timely interventions, improving patient outcomes and preserving vision.
Eye care professionals also help patients choose corrective measures, such as prescriptions for glasses or contact lenses, that meet their specific vision needs. More comprehensive eye care services may include vision therapy and surgical procedures to address severe conditions. By providing a wide range of services, eye care specialists reinforce the importance of maintaining optimal visual health throughout life.
